"The Old Stone Church (The First Presbyterian Society in Cleveland) PUBLIC SQUARE Cleveland, Ohio 44113 Is one of America's most widely-known and influential churches. The congregation was organized in 1820, when Cleveland was a village of 150 inhabitants, and is the oldest Presbyterian organization in the city. The present edifice dedicated in 1858, is the third structure on the present site. The Church is open daily for rest, meditation, and prayer." -- card verso.
